Alnico -

The development of alnico began in 1931, when T. Mishima in Japan discovered that an alloy of iron, nickel, and aluminum had a much higher coercivity than the best steel magnets of the time. The composition of alnico alloys is typically 8–12% Al, 15–26% Ni, 5–24% Co, up to 6% Cu, up to 1% Ti, and the balance is Fe.

1  · Cast alnico magnets are manufactured by pouring a molten metal alloy into a mold and then processing it through various heat-treat cycles. The resulting magnet has a dark gray appearance and may have a rough surface. ... For best results with alnico 5 magnets, the length should be no less than 5 times the cross-section diameter; or 5 times the ...

How Alnico Magnets are made | Bunting - eMagnets

Titanium (Ti) 0% -9%. Niobium (Nb) 0% -3%. Iron (Fe) Balance (e.g. 30% -40%) An example for sintered Alnico 8 is – 31.5% Iron, 36% Cobalt, 13.5% Nickel, 7.2% Aluminium, 3.5% Copper, 7.5% Titanium and 0.8%Niobium. Alnico magnets can be made from either sintering or by the more common casting processes. The Alnico structure is one of a strongly ...
